|
@@ -772,7 +772,7 @@ public class LoanApplicationServiceImpl implements ILoanApplicationService {
|
|
|
}
|
|
|
LoanApplication application = new LoanApplication();
|
|
|
application.setLoanApplicationId(loanApplication.getLoanApplicationId());
|
|
|
- application.setAuditType(ONE);
|
|
|
+ application.setAuditType(TWO);
|
|
|
if (SEV.equals(loanSchedule)) {
|
|
|
application.setLoanSchedule(EIG);
|
|
|
application.setAuditSchedule(NIN);
|
|
@@ -844,22 +844,31 @@ public class LoanApplicationServiceImpl implements ILoanApplicationService {
|
|
|
List<WaitRemind> waitRemindList = new ArrayList<>();
|
|
|
|
|
|
LoanApplication loanApplicationOld = loanApplicationMapper.selectLoanApplicationByLoanApplicationId(loanApplicationId);
|
|
|
- reviewCommentsMapper.deleteReviewCommentsByLoanApplicationIdAndAuditSchedule(loanApplicationId, auditSchedule);
|
|
|
+ //reviewCommentsMapper.deleteReviewCommentsByLoanApplicationIdAndAuditSchedule(loanApplicationId, auditSchedule);
|
|
|
if (Integer.parseInt(loanSchedule) < 2 || Integer.parseInt(auditSchedule) < 1 || Integer.parseInt(loanApplicationType) != 2) {
|
|
|
return AjaxResult.error("当前项目不可撤销");
|
|
|
}
|
|
|
if (Integer.parseInt(loanSchedule) > 7) {
|
|
|
//撤销只返回贷款申请进度到上一步
|
|
|
loanApplication.setLoanSchedule(String.valueOf(Integer.parseInt(loanSchedule) - 1));
|
|
|
+ loanApplication.setAuditSchedule(String.valueOf(Integer.parseInt(auditSchedule) - 1));
|
|
|
} else {
|
|
|
//如果是待审核的撤销就退一步否则就是改为待审核
|
|
|
- if (ONE.equals(auditType)) {
|
|
|
+ if (ONE.equals(auditType) ) {
|
|
|
loanApplication.setAuditSchedule(String.valueOf(Integer.parseInt(auditSchedule) - 1));
|
|
|
loanApplication.setLoanSchedule(String.valueOf(Integer.parseInt(loanSchedule) - 1));
|
|
|
+ //等于6:评审会撤销
|
|
|
+ if (SIX.equals(loanSchedule)) {
|
|
|
+ loanApplication.setReviewSchedule(ONE);
|
|
|
+ String reviewSchedule = loanApplication.getReviewSchedule();
|
|
|
+ if (FOR.equals(reviewSchedule)){
|
|
|
+ //撤销到确认上会
|
|
|
+ loanApplication.setReviewSchedule(THR);
|
|
|
+ loanApplication.setReviewTime("");
|
|
|
+ }
|
|
|
+ }
|
|
|
}
|
|
|
- if (SEV.equals(loanSchedule)) {
|
|
|
- loanApplication.setLoanSchedule(SIX);
|
|
|
- }
|
|
|
+
|
|
|
//进入待审核
|
|
|
loanApplication.setAuditType(ONE);
|
|
|
String type = "-1";
|